|
c++ 과 빌더를 병행하며 공부하는 초짜생입니다.
cport로 장비제어 공부중입니다.
일단 쓰는것만.. 단계별로 공부하려구요..
여기홈에서 여러가지 방법들을 읽어보고 지금은 232통신 쓰기만 일단 해보았습니다.
쓰는 것은 메모장으로 com1 -> com2로 성공을 했구요..
이번엔 장비에 쓰려고하는데 stx,command,etx,bcc이렇게 보내야 되는데,
값들은 모두 hex 값이구요..
void __fastcall TTform::Button_SendClick(TObject *Sender)
{
AnsiString Str;
//Str = Edit_Data->Text;
Str = RichEdit1 ->Text;
if (NewLine_CB->Checked)
Str = Str + "\r\n";
ComPort1->WriteStr(Str);
ComLed1-> State = lsOn;
RichEdit1 -> Clear();
}
이렇게 해서 문자 전송은 했습니다.
hex값은 어떻게 보내죠?? 궁금합니다.
한번 도와 주십시요..
|